Secret Characteristics of Counterfeit Money
Comprehending how to identify counterfeit notes helps in the battle against this concern. Here are some common attributes that help in detection:

Watermarks: Genuine currency often includes unique watermarks that are challenging to duplicate.

Color-Shifting Ink: Many contemporary banknotes utilize ink that changes color when viewed from different angles.

Microprinting: Small text that is hard to see with the naked eye however exists on legitimate notes is often missing or duplicated inadequately on counterfeit costs.

Feel and Texture: Genuine money is printed on a distinct type of paper, giving it a specific feel. Counterfeit notes often feel different, as they might be printed on regular paper.

Security Threads: This ingrained thread is a common security function in lots of banknotes.

Regardless of these features, counterfeiters have created increasingly advanced approaches that often can deceive even meticulous people.
The Legal Landscape of Counterfeiting
Counterfeiting is a criminal offense in practically every country on the planet. The legal ramifications can be extreme, including whatever from significant fines to substantial jail sentences. Moreover, legislation is continually adapted to attend to new methods of counterfeiting.

In the United States, for example, the Secret Service was initially established to fight currency counterfeiting and has actually stayed at the leading edge of this fight. They use various methods, consisting of public education, to assist citizens identify counterfeit money.

Steps to Combat Counterfeiting
In reaction to these difficulties, banks, governments, and police have carried out different protective procedures, including:

Advanced Security Features: Continuous enhancement in the security features of banknotes, including holograms and complex styles.

Public Awareness Campaigns: Educating citizens on how to discover counterfeit notes and report suspicious activities.

Cooperation Between Agencies: Cooperation between international law enforcement and financial entities is vital in locating and prosecuting counterfeiters.
